LEASES Leases
Lessee Arrangements
Operating Leases
We lease real estate and equipment used in operations from third parties. As of June 30, 2023, the remaining term of our operating leases ranged from 1 to 16 years with various automatic extensions.

As of June 30, 2023, the Company has entered into an operating lease for additional office space that has not yet commenced for approximately $1.4 million. This operating lease will commence during fiscal year 2024 with a lease term of 12 years.
